The authors consider the parametric identification of linear discrete- time systems with known bounded disturbances. Projection and least- squares algorithms are modified to cope up with bounded disturbances. Both of these algorithms have been obtained by optimizing performance indexes. Through convergence analysis it is shown that the estimated parameters remain bounded, the estimated increments converge to zero and that the prediction error, passed through a dead zone and normalized, converges to zero.
